Ashnikko – has announced their sophomore album “Smoochies” + released the video for ‘Trinkets’ & set to play Dublin next year

Pop disruptor, Ashnikko has announced their sophomore album “Smoochies”, out 17th October. In celebration of this announcement, Ashnikko has released the music video for ‘Trinkets’ released earlier this week and announced a UK tour in February 2026.

Premiered on Radio 1 as Jack Saunders ”Hottest Record”’, Trinkets sees Ashnikko turn casual dating into an art form, collecting men like shiny souvenirs as she sings about her conquests over a chaotic, candy-coated beat. Directed by Léa Esmaili the music video gives us inside access to Ashnikko’s art nouveau candy coloured world brimming with doll parts, ashtrays, D&D dice and keychains of men. In a time where minimalism and clean girl aesthetic is on the rise, Ashnikko leans into maximalism as a form of expression.
